Company History and Business Evolution

ParkMobile was founded in 2008 by Jon Ziglar and David Gibbons, initially as a pilot project in Cleveland, Ohio. The vision was to eliminate the hassle of carrying coins and waiting at parking meters by enabling mobile payments. Early iterations focused on SMS-based payments, a novel concept at the time. In 2010, the company launched its first smartphone app, quickly gaining traction in major cities like New York and San Francisco. A pivotal moment came in 2012 when ParkMobile secured $12 million in Series A funding led by Qiming Venture Partners. This capital fueled expansion into new markets and the development of a proprietary parking sensor network. By 2015, ParkMobile had surpassed 1 million downloads and partnered with over 1,000 parking operators. The company continued to innovate, introducing dynamic pricing, reservation capabilities, and integration with navigation apps. In 2018, ParkMobile was acquired by BMW iVentures, the venture capital arm of the BMW Group, gaining access to automotive expertise and global distribution channels. The acquisition accelerated development of connected car integrations, allowing drivers to pay for parking directly from their vehicle’s infotainment system. In 2020, ParkMobile merged with competitor ParkMobile (note: same name), consolidating its market position. The pandemic period saw a shift toward digital touch less payments, further boosting adoption. Today, ParkMobile operates as a subsidiary of the BMW Group but maintains an autonomous startup culture. Its platform handles over 50 million transactions annually and continues to expand through strategic partnerships with ride-sharing services, fleet operators, and smart city initiatives. The company’s evolution from a simple SMS service to a comprehensive mobility platform exemplifies adaptability and foresight in the rapidly changing automotive landscape.

Products, Technologies, and Services

ParkMobile offers a comprehensive suite of products: the flagship ParkMobile App for consumers, enabling pay-by-plate, reservations, and extensions; ParkMobile for Business providing operators with real-time analytics, revenue management, and enforcement tools; White-Label Solutions allowing municipalities and event venues to brand their own parking apps; Connected Car Integration enabling in-dash payment through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and BMW’s system; API Platform for third-party developers to embed parking functionality into apps; ParkMobile SDK for IoT devices like sensors and cameras. Technologically, ParkMobile relies on a microservices architecture hosted on AWS, using machine learning for demand prediction, and blockchain for secure payment verification. The platform processes over 100 million API calls daily with 99.99% uptime. It supports multiple payment methods including credit cards, digital wallets, fleet accounts, and cryptocurrencies. Security features include tokenization, biometric authentication, and real-time fraud detection. The company holds several patents for location-based services and dynamic pricing algorithms. ParkMobile also offers a Pay-by-Text service for markets without smartphones.

Job Details & Requirements for this Posting

Role: Senior Software Engineer – Platform Team

Location: Atlanta, GA (hybrid) or Remote (US-only)

Salary: $130,000 – $170,000 + equity + benefits

Job Type: Full-time

Responsibilities

  • Design, build, and maintain scalable microservices for the ParkMobile platform handling millions of transactions.
  • Collaborate with product managers to define and implement new features for parking reservations, payments, and real-time occupancy.
  • Optimize database performance (PostgreSQL, DynamoDB) and ensure high availability across AWS regions.
  • Lead code reviews, mentor junior engineers, and contribute to engineering standards.
  • Implement CI/CD pipelines with Docker, Kubernetes, and GitHub Actions.
  • Participate in on-call rotation to maintain service reliability.
  • Work with IoT teams to integrate parking sensors and connected vehicle APIs.

Qualifications

  • 5+ years of professional software engineering experience.
  • Proficiency in at least one of: Java, Go, Python, or Node.js.
  • Experience with RESTful API design and GraphQL.
  • Strong understanding of distributed systems and cloud-native architectures.
  • Experience with event-driven systems (Kafka, SQS).
  • Knowledge of parking or automotive industry is a plus.
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to work in a remote team.
